rs=sql1.executequery("select*fromtable1where编号="+变量名);这样写就可以了如果编号是字符型那就得这样写rs=sql1.executequery("select*fromtable1where编号='"+变量名+"'");
- 情感问答
- 答案列表
jsp查询:jsp查询数据库[朗读]
jsp查询关键字是用户通过文本框输入后传到db检索结果然后返回页面.举例如下:<%@pagecontenttype="text/html;charset=gb2312"%><%@pagelanguage="java
1.首先你要先学会如何在java中连接数据库2.拿到你想要的数据之后,你必须能将数据返回给前台的jsp页面3.在jsp页面中循环展示你的查询结果。
1.通过jdbc连接上数据库,并从中获取一个连接.(建议由一个工具类提供)2.创建一个jsp页面、一个servlet类和一个service业务逻辑类.3.当点击查询按钮时调用servlet并把文本框中的参数传递过去.4.在servlet中获取页面传递过来的参数,并调用service中方法(此方法负责条件查询并返回list集合)5.servlet中把查询集合放到request作用域并转发到jsp页面进行迭代,把数据取出展示即可。
需要将这条语句在数据库中执行后得到返回的值dataset之后循环弹出结果.具体在百度中查询jsp数据库查询来看.你现在还有很多要学.数据库是jsp的重中之重。